Teachers are often looking for ways for their students to move and explore throughout the day. These sensory tools will be available in either a Multi-Sensory Environment for students to visit or through a check-out system for teachers to borrow items to bring into their classroom.
These items will allow students to regulate their sensory systems to be able to best attend and learn in the classroom. These items will provide activities involving movement (swing and stepping stones), pressure/weight (peapod chair and heavy ropes), and touch (theraputty) for our students who need this type of input throughout the day. The light projector helps to set a calming tone within the room.
